Transaction 4453caf493c354f14a08b6267cdbec87b53d830fd29aa86ee51ef75c961c6f5c

24 Input
2 Outputs
  • 4453caf493c354f14a08b6267cdbec87b53d830fd29aa86ee51ef75c961c6f5c:0
  • value  95738509
    address  1Ffon49vKWgbXRn6QavG91vQMYmYZqaQC2
  • 4453caf493c354f14a08b6267cdbec87b53d830fd29aa86ee51ef75c961c6f5c:1
  • value  1510234
    address  bc1q8vqk8jqukd5u5m054y2q5qgfhs7lkrry95pr7g